A skate park pump track is essentially a series of rollers, berms, and jumps that are designed to be ridden without the need for pedaling. Instead of using your pedals to gain speed, riders generate momentum by pumping their body weight through the track’s features. This creates a fluid and continuous motion that mimics the feeling of surfing or snowboarding, making for a truly exhilarating ride.

Another benefit of skate park pump tracks is their accessibility. Unlike traditional skate parks and bike trails, pump tracks can be built in a relatively small space, making them ideal for urban environments where space is limited. This means that more communities can enjoy the benefits of pump track riding without having to travel long distances to find a suitable location.

In addition to being fun and challenging, skate park pump tracks also provide a great workout. Pumping your way through the track requires a combination of strength, balance, and coordination, making it a full-body workout that can help improve your fitness and stamina. Plus, the repetitive nature of pump track riding can help improve your muscle memory and overall riding skills, making you a better rider in the long run.
